I downloaded a ton of Marvel characters, but I can't figure out how to use them, can anyone help me figure it out?
Buttonmashing?
No, no, no, that's my usual strategy, I can't figure out how to install them.
1st: Put each of the character folders (not the RAR files you might have downloaded) into you MUGEN's char folder.
2nd: Go to the data folder and open the "select" text document. NotePad is fine.
3rd: Go to the section with the title [Characters]. Skip past the tutorial text with the semicolons, and look for a a line like this:
Code: [Select]
kfm, random4th: Under the above line, type the exact name of each character folder you placed in char. You may also wish to add the ", random", which will tell the game to choose a random stage when you fight that character. Make sure each character/stage combination is on a different line. Example:
Code: [Select]
WarMachine, random
ryuDG, random
ultrarox_vice, random
5th: Save the select file.
6th: Run MUGEN!
